two.1.4) Short description

The short break care offer for families in Richmond and Kingston has two elements: specialist

or assessed support for children and young people with complex needs; and universal or

unassessed services. This procurement is for the universal or unassessed Short Breaks offer.

That is to say that this procurement is for commissioned universal services that do not

include overnight respite or specialist care. To be eligible for the universal programme,

children and young people must have a diagnosed disability, be aged between 4-17, and live

in either Richmond or Kingston borough. Children who are eligible for specialist (assessed)

short break care can additionally access the universal programme.

This procurement opportunity requires providers to have building based provision in either/or both Kingston and Richmond Boroughs.

Please see the tender documentation for further details of all requirements.

This procurement is divided in Lots and Sub-Lots.

Contract(s) will be for an initial term of two years with one 12 months extension period available to be taken at the discretion of AfC.

The Authority is using an Open Procedure for this procurement of services categorised as ‘social and other specific services’ under Schedule 3 of the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 (‘PCR 2015’). This procurement exercise will therefore be subject to the Light Touch Regime (‘LTR’) under Regulations 74 to 77 as set out in the Public Contracts Regulations 2015.
